Enregistrement de paramètres
B.2 Erreur de validation de paramètre
B.2
Erreur de validation de paramètre
Si vous effectuez le paramétrage dans STEP 7 (TIA Portal) ou dans STEP 7 , les valeurs de
paramètres sont vérifiées avant d'être transférées au module technologique. Cela permet
d'éviter des erreurs de paramètres.
Dans les autres cas d'application, le module technologique vérifie l'enregistrement de
paramètres transféré. Si le module technologique détecte des valeurs de paramètres non
autorisées ou incohérentes, il émet un code d'erreur (voir ci-dessous). Dans ce cas, le
nouvel enregistrement de paramètres est refusé et les anciennes valeurs de paramètres
sont conservées jusqu'à ce qu'un enregistrement de paramètres valide soit transféré.
WRREC
Vous pouvez modifier l'enregistrement de paramètres à l'état de fonctionnement RUN de la
CPU avec l'instruction WRREC (Write Record). L'instruction WRREC renvoie des codes
d'erreur correspondants en cas d'erreur dans le paramètre STATUS.
Exemple :
Supposons que l'exécution de WRREC entraîne l'écriture d'une valeur non autorisée dans le
module, p. ex. 9, pour le mode de fonctionnement. En conséquence, le module refuse
l'enregistrement de paramètres entier. Vous le détectez en évaluant le paramètre de sortie
STATUS de l'instruction WRREC. Le paramètre de sortie STATUS est affiché comme un
ARRAY[1..4] de données BYTE avec la valeur 16#DF80E111 :
Exemple
WRREC
Données
STATUS
DF
H
80
H
E1
H
11
H
82
Adresse
Signification
STATUS[1]
Erreur lors de l'écriture d'un enregistrement via PROFINET IO
(CEI 61158-6)
STATUS[2]
Erreur lors de la lecture ou de l'écriture d'un enregistrement via
PROFINET IO (CEI 61158-6)
STATUS[3]
Erreur spécifique au module
STATUS[4]
Code d'erreur du tableau suivant :
Le paramètre "Mode de fonctionnement" a une valeur non autori-
sée.
Module technologique TM Count 2x24V (6ES7550‑1AA00‑0AB0)
Manuel, 06/2018, A5E31870372-AB